Old Black Hills Pioneer Jean Becker Visits Miles City

Jean Becker a long time Miles City resident and former Deadwood stagecoach guard shares frontier memories from the Black Hills era He rode as one of five shotgun messengers guarding gold shipments to Pierre guarding against robberies while delivering bullion He now serves as city editor of the Yellowstone Journal and recounts vivid life on the frontier.

Looking After Pensioners in State Inspections

Major Sues, the government pension agent from Sioux Falls, visited the city to audit pension payments and verify beneficiaries. He found a mis-spelled enlistment name caused decades of payments under the wrong name and expects correction, though it will burden the pensioner. He will continue inspections in other areas after returning home.

H. G. Nichols Noted In Coursing Circles

In Sportsman Review a portrait and notice profile H G Nichols of Mitchell South Dakota. He is long time secretary of the American Coursing Club first elected at Huron in 1896 and re elected annually through 1899. Nichols runs about fifteen dogs including three imports Swansea Menominee and May Herschel and plans to send greyhounds to California for upcoming events next week.

New Rule for Canceling Revenue Stamps Reduces Fraud

The government issues a circular on canceling ten cent or larger documentary stamps. It requires the user to write their name and date and mutilate the stamp by three parallel cuts lengthwise, unless already cancelled by existing regulations.
